A Fresh Marketing Strategy for Converting Cold Leads

Boom Town

You’ve heard all about the importance of following up with your leads. Check in with your hottest leads first, and then touch base with your “warm” and “cold” leads periodically to make sure they’re staying engaged. But what about those leads that aren’t quite ready to talk? Remarketing. Most agents use these three ways to reach out to leads: Call, Email, Text.

Is a Transit-Oriented Development a Good Area for Your Next Flip?

Patch of Land

What is a Transit-Oriented Development? Before we explain why a transit-oriented development might be a smart market for your next flip, let’s define this type of development. A transit-oriented development is a vibrant, walkable urban community with a mixture of housing, offices, retail shops, dining, entertainment, and other amenities—all centered around reliable public transportation, often a rail system.
